+# Tensorflow Android Camera Demo
+
+This folder contains a simple camera-based demo application utilizing Tensorflow.
+
+## Description
+
+This demo uses a Google Inception model to classify camera frames in real-time,
+displaying the top results in an overlay on the camera image. See
+assets/imagenet_comp_graph_label_strings.txt for the possible classificiations.

+## To build/install/run
+
+As a pre-requisite, Bazel, the Android NDK, and the Android SDK must all be
+installed on your system. The Android build tools may be obtained from:
+https://developer.android.com/tools/revisions/build-tools.html
+
+The Android entries in [<workspace_root>/WORKSPACE](../../WORKSPACE) must be
+uncommented with the paths filled in appropriately depending on where you
+installed the NDK and SDK. Otherwise an error such as:
+"The external label '//external:android/sdk' is not bound to anything" will
+be reported.
+
+
+To build the APK, run this from your workspace root:
+```
+bazel build //tensorflow/examples/android:tensorflow_demo -c opt --copt=-mfpu=neon
+```
+Note that "-c opt" is currently required; if not set, an assert (for an
+otherwise non-problematic issue) in Eigen will halt the application during
+execution. This issue will be corrected in an upcoming release.
+
+If adb debugging is enabled on your device, you may instead use the following
+command from your workspace root to automatically build and install:
+```
+bazel mobile-install //tensorflow/examples/android:tensorflow_demo -c opt --copt=-mfpu=neon
+```
+
+Add the "--start_app" flag if you wish to automatically start the app after
+installing. Otherwise, find the application icon labeled "Tensorflow Demo".
